When you’re looking to organise a national tour for a production, band or comedy act, finding a theatre that’s suitable and affordable can be tricky if you’re not a known name or act.

A significant knock-on effect of cuts to arts funding at both local and national level has been the need for theatres to change their contracts. Two-way box office ‘splits’ are heavily stacked in the theatre’s favour, reducing their financial risk, but potentially leaving performers out of pocket before they even step onto stage. Hire charges have risen too, putting many municipal venues beyond the reach of new companies and acts alike.

Cue the independent school theatre

However, there is a secret source of exceptional performing spaces ready and waiting to welcome your performance. Nearly all independent schools have superb theatres kitted out with the latest theatre technologies and backstage facilities, and available for hire.

What’s more, private schools are often keen to attract touring productions as they bring people into the school who otherwise might not ever see inside the gates. What’s more, there is usually ample off-road parking for audience members, and easy access for both get in and get out crews.

The Hunt Theatre, Felsted School, Essex

This intimate theatre is ideal for a whole range of productions, including comedy set try-outs and one-person shows. Seating 150, the theatre has a fully installed technical setup, and two dressing rooms backstage. An established and popular venue in the area, the theatre regularly hosts professional touring shows from companies such as Out of Joint, Eastern Angles and Scamp.

The Greek Theatre, Bradfield College, Reading, Berkshire

This exceptional venue is a faithful reproduction of an open air ancient Greek theatre, built in an old chalk pit in the heart of the school grounds. Completely restored in 2014, the amphitheatre features traditional stone tiered seating in a horseshoe shape around the orchestra (circular performing area), an extended stage area, and a smart new wooden skene (backstage building). Even if you don’t know your Euripides from your elbow, it’s a stunning space for plays, musicals, and performance poetry, performed under the stars.

The Theatre, Ibstock Place School, Richmond Park, London

This is a true gem, a new 300-seat theatre with a low stage, tiered retractable seating for 300, an orchestra pit, extensive foyer and bar, green room, and dressing rooms. Constructed in pale, stripped wood, and with state of the art technical facilities, this is a theatre to treasure for almost any kind of staged performance or concert. There’s even a separate studio theatre for rehearsals, Friends events or press receptions.

The Ryan Theatre Harrow School, London

The Ryan Theatre is Harrow School’s purpose built theatre, built in 1994 and seating up to 389 in a shallow and wide auditorium with excellent views from all seats (and plenty of legroom too!). The theatre boasts a large stage, with the further option of a thrust stage or sunken orchestra pit if required. There is a proper Foyer, and a Saloon on the ground floor for drinks receptions. With excellent local transport links to central London and local parking, this is a smart, well-equipped theatre space with its own team of creative, technical and administrative professionals.
